KNCK (1390 kHz) is a classic hits music formatted AM radio station licensed to Concordia, Kansas, serving Concordia and Cloud County, Kansas. KNCK is owned and operated by Barbara White, through licensee White Communications, LLC. The station derives a portion of its programming from Jones Radio Network's "Kool Gold" Network.

History

Local businessman Charles Cook, who made his fortune by starting a brick manufacturing plant called Cloud Ceramics, helped start KNCK in 1954.
